HC07 has been and gone and a great time was had by all. We walked miles and miles (and miles) and only got lost once or twice. The weather was fantastic yet again and the company was even better. This year HC07 was enjoyed by 237 delegates, who came from 23 clubs, including for ladies from a club from Spain. As well as Spain our delegation also included 2 ladies from Holland Harmony, 1 from Norway and 1 who was just somebody's mum who fancied a weekend away and threw herself into everything all weekend! Our faculty of 20 taught or presented 61 (yes sixty one!) classes or rehearsals in just one weekend! Our final performance on Sunday afternoon saw 177 of our ladies perform in either their own quartet, one of our fantastic choruses, or as an MC from Anita's MC Master class - you really did all make me very proud, but I have to admit to being ridiculously proud of the stunning performance of the Youth Chorus that brought a real lump to my throat (trust me that's no mean feat!).
